Full Job Description
Job Description

At Gilead our pursuit of a healthier world for all people has yielded a cure for hepatitis C, revolutionary improvements in HIV treatment and prevention as well as advancements in therapies for viral and inflammatory diseases and certain cancers.

We set and achieve bold ambitions in our fight against the world's most devastating diseases, united in our commitment to confronting the largest public health challenges of our day and improving the lives of patients for generations to come. As a Principal Scientist, Process Development at Gilead you will ...
  • Be responsible for developing chemical processes for the manufacturing of drug substances
  • Demonstrate technical knowledge, scientific creativity, and collaboration skills in the development and execution of research for the preparation of novel chemical substances
  • Plan, execute and analyze laboratory experimentation to advance the knowledge of production and quality attributes of drug substances
  • Propose alternative chemistry, including new route selection and step optimization
  • Provide regular updates to supervision and proposes future research directions
  • In collaboration with senior scientists, develops project strategy for manufacturing of drug substances to support clinical studies and commercialization
  • Responsible for the day to day management of project team members and research assignments, including designing and interpreting of experimentation
  • Prepare and review technical documents including research reports, process development reports, and documentation for the manufacturing of chemical substances e.g. Master Batch Records (MBRs)
  • Collaborate across functional areas including analytical chemistry, quality assurance, and manufacturing to accomplish project goals. Acts as a subject matter expert for cross-functional teams and research personnel
  • Provide technical support for manufacturing processes performed under cGMP in laboratory manufacturing and large-scale manufacturing operations
  • Ensure that all experimentation is carried out in accordance with appropriate standard operating procedures (SOPs), maintaining quality, safety, and environmental standards


Knowledge, Experience and Skills:
  • PhD in Organic Chemistry (or related discipline) and 5+ years of relevant experience minimum required. OR
  • MSc degree with extensive industry experience (8+ years) OR
  • BSc degree with extensive industry experience (10+ years)
  • Experience in planning and executing multi-step synthesis of organic molecules
  • Experience scaling up synthetic routes and developing safe processes
  • Familiarity with purification and analytical techniques, including HPLC, LCMS and NMR
  • Familiarity with pilot plant and/or plant operations, and experience with generating master batch records is an asset
  • Familiarity with process validation, regulatory filings and cGMP regulatory guidelines is an asset
  • Strong desire to work in multi-disciplinary teams, learn new skills and solve problems
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ills, and strong interpersonal collaboration skills
  • Must think critically and creatively and be able to work independently to determine appropriate resources for resolution of problems
  • Strong organizational and planning skills
  • Experience with project and people management is an asset

About Gilead Sciences Inc

Gilead Sciences is a research-based biopharmaceutical company that discovers, develops, and commercializes innovative medicines in areas of unmet need. With each new discovery and experimental drug candidate, they seek to improve the care of patients suffering from life-threatening diseases. Gilead's primary areas of focus include HIV/AIDS, liver disease, and serious cardiovascular and respiratory conditions.
